iTunes (Win10) won't recognize my iPhone 12 Pro Max

iTunes won't recognize my new iPhone 12 Pro Max. I get this error sometimes:


"An iPhone has been detected, but it could not be identified properly. Please disconnect..."


I have the version of iTunes installed from the Microsoft store and so there is no "Check for updates" button available under help in iTunes. At first iTunes showed me a grayed out iphone icon where it's supposed to be. So I tried updating my phone to 14.3... now I don't even see that little grayed out iPhone icon.. I only get that error sometimes. Windows does detect the phone though. I can see the photos through file explorer etc.


My PC is an AMD Ryzen 2700X on an Asus Prime X470 motherboard


Anyone know whats going on?

iPhone 12 Pro Max, iOS 14
